I am going to recommend the game Brawl Stars.

 

This is a mobile game. If you like to be the best in games and have the best things in the game, then I suggest that you read this review about Brawl Stars. Brawl Stars helped me become a pro in several games and it can also help you.

 

This is a game with different game modes, you can play as a duo or in a team of three. There are also different types of maps, among them are: Survival, Gem Catch, Brawl Ball, Heist, Restricted Zone, Knockout, and the most important Competitive Mode. The game shows if you are good at playing because here there are seven ranks you can be placed in. 

 

This game is pay to win like most games, but if you are good at playing you can get good characters for free, it is not necessary to pay.

 

In my opinion, it is a good game. I already have 8,000 trophies and in Competitive Mode I am a diamond rank. I started playing this game in 2019. This game has been a very good experience. I recommend it because it is very fun because you earn trophies, which is very satisfying in my opinion. This game is for ages thirty and below because it is not suitable for everyone. I like that every month they add new brawlers, so there are many brawlers available. It is easy to play, the game gives you a tutorial, just follow it, and the only thing you have to do is kill your enemies. This game is multiplayer. You face other players of your trophy level. It depends on how many trophies you have. If you have 3000 trophies, you will have to fight against players of the same trophy level.

 

In conclusion, it is a very good game and I hope you play it too.
